Welcome bonus and wagering requirements explained

Fat Pirate advertises a “welcome package” that combines a deposit match bonus and a few free spins on a popular slot. The match is usually 100 % up to £200, plus 50 free spins on a featured game. This looks generous, but the fine print matters.

The wagering requirement on the bonus amount is 30×, meaning you must bet thirty times the bonus value before you can withdraw any winnings derived from it. Free spin winnings are often subject to a lower 20× requirement. For a beginner, it helps to calculate the total amount you need to turn over – for a £200 bonus you would need to place £6,000 in bets before cashing out.

Payment methods and withdrawal speed

UK players have a decent selection of deposit options at Fat Pirate: debit/credit cards (Visa, Mastercard), popular e‑wallets such as PayPal, Skrill and Neteller, plus direct bank transfer. Most deposits are processed instantly, allowing you to jump straight into the action.

Withdrawals are a little slower. E‑wallet payouts usually arrive within 24 hours, while card withdrawals can take 2‑3 business days. Bank transfers are the longest, often 4‑5 days. The casino does not charge a fee for withdrawals, but you should check if your own bank imposes any charges.
